    1. If the ref asked Meldrick Taylor a question, and he failed to respond, then the stoppage against Chavez was legit regardless of how much time was left on the clock.

    2. Jack Dempsey is astonsihingly overrated. Astonishingly. He almost certainly loaded the gloves against Willard. Wills was the real champ.

    3. Max Schmeling was a great heavyweight. He should be recognized as a two time champion, becauuse he should have got the shot against Braddock, and Braddock should have been stripped for non-defense.

    4. Rocky Marciano had some of the best defenses at heavyweight, not some of the worst. Certainly better than Joe Luis'.

    5. Jack Johnson should be derrided has having drawn the color line, just like any white fighter.

    6.The real title holders of that era were the black fighters., with the possible exception of Jeffries who beat the best black fighters on the way up.

    7. Tommy Hearns is 2 and 0 against Leonard. The first fight was a quick stoppage in which he was ahead on points, and the second an outright screwjob.

    8. Salvador Sanchez should be recognized as a top twenty ATG guy just for his wins over Gomez and Nelson, who went on to be great. Wins against Laporte, Lopez etc. don't hurt either.


    9. We should alter records so that they have asterisks on every one. It should be officially noted that eveyone knows that Whitiker beat Chavez, Fenech beat Nelson, etc. etc. It should at the very least be noted in some officail capacity that some important fights are highly disputed.

    10. I like public scoring.

    11. It it could be proven that headgear would help reduce brain damage, I would have no problem with the pros wearing it. Those guys fight for our entertainment- lets give them evey possible chance.

    12. Ezzard Charles is a top ten PfP guy. He is a middleweight who thrice defeated Archie Moore, lifted the heavyweight belt, got a win over Joe Luis, and gave Marciano hs toughest fights. Incredible.
